Does Johns Hopkins Medicine have Non-Clinical Professional Jobs in Maryland? Yes, they can include:
Activities Assistant Team members in these non-clinical professional jobs responsible for assisting with the day to day delivery of resident centered activities and programs while meeting and/or exceeding quality standards.
Associate Chaplain – PRN - Team members in these non-clinical professional jobs create and support a sacred space so that patients, families and staff experience help, hope and healing.
Translator Float - Team members in these non-clinical professional jobs translate documents, such as patient education materials, hospital forms, patient letters, medical records, and marketing materials.
